It is hardly reassuring for a security team to reject a credible attack warning without giving it due weight. However, this risk is amplified by an excess of false alarms and false alerts, which can lead to alert fatigue. Every security tool designed for attack detection will inevitably make mistakes. For decades, researchers and vendors have worked to improve the accuracy of threat detection without compromising performance. Identifying attacks requires a constant trade-off between false negatives, when a tool misses a real attack, and false positives, when a tool flags benign activity as malicious. Methods that reduce false alarms typically result in more false positives. When this balance is disrupted, false positives can impair the effectiveness of the security team. Cybersecurity solutions that can generate false alarms in threat detection include anti-malware, anti-phishing, SIEM, Intrusion Detection and Prevention Systems, DLP, firewalls, and EDR. Security managers must know how frequently their security tools generate false alarms.
